Remember the Y2K hysteria? Although it failed to live up to the hype, the real fallout of Y2K was the cost of upgrading computer equipment. Naturally there were lawsuits -- generally in the form of corporations seeking to recover upgrade costs under their insurance policies. But now the lawsuits are becoming part of the past as well. The appointment of independent monitors, almost unheard of for mainstream corporations 15 years ago, has lately played out with increasing frequency. Supporters of monitorships say they ensure that corporations address problems that led to the investigation, says Chadbourne & Parke counsel Douglas Jensen, while critics say the government calls for monitorships in cases where they're not warranted and imbues monitors with an inappropriate degree of authority over businesses with which they are unfamiliar.Trending Stories
